Experienced mesothelioma attorneys can make claims against asbestos trust funds on behalf of their clients as well as filing mesothelioma lawsuits. These are funds that have been set aside by negligent asbestos companies in the event they go bankrupt. These monies can be used to pay mesothelioma compensation to victims.

A mesothelioma law team can also bring wrongful death lawsuits on behalf of loved ones who have died from asbestos exposure. The compensation awarded in these cases can aid family members in remunerating funeral expenses, income loss and more.

Contingency fees

A diagnosis of mesothelioma can be a nightmare and a source of anxiety not only for the person who is diagnosed with the disease, but also for their loved ones. Medical expenses, lost income and long-term costs could be a cause for concern. The compensation from trusts or lawsuits can ease the burden. A mesothelioma lawyer can help families and victims receive the financial support they require.

Most mesothelioma lawyers operate on a contingency basis, meaning that they only receive compensation for their services if their client receives a settlement or verdict. This allows victims and their family members to pursue justice without worrying about paying their lawyer. This arrangement is particularly beneficial for people with illnesses that prevent them from working or going to court to defend their rights.
